Our Mission

The Williams Elementary Parent-Teacher Organization (PTO) is a dedicated group of parents, guardians, and staff working together to support and enrich students’ learning while strengthening our school community.

 

Our mission is to create a collaborative and inclusive environment where families and educators join forces to enhance the educational experience for every student. Through fundraising, volunteer efforts, and community events, we provide essential resources, programs, and services that help students thrive both inside and outside the classroom.

 

From funding classroom supplies and schoolwide initiatives to organizing fun and enriching activities, the PTO plays a vital role in making Williams Elementary a place where children can learn, grow, and succeed.
